Industry: Venture Capital and Private Equity, focusing on supporting outlier founders building transformative tech

Company Size: 201-500 employees, with a global network of over 50,000 professionals

Founded: 2020, with a mission to back the top 0.1% of founders with up to €500,000 in immediate funding and weekly 1:1 mentorship from unicorn founders

Company Description:

  • EWOR is a fellowship for outlier founders building transformative tech
  • Backed by serial entrepreneurs with a collective exit value of over €12bn
  • Offers tailored support, not standardised programming, with a virtual-first approach
